Web11 Jun 2024 · The team discovered the 340-year-old shipwreck in 2007, but it wasn't until 2012 they found the ship's bell and then the Ministry of Defence and Receiver of Wreck … Web6 Jun 2010 · On June 17, 1850, a steamer called the G. P. Griffith was en route from Buffalo to Toledo on Lake Erie when a fire erupted in the dark hours of the early morning. The boat was a few miles out from the shoreline, east of the city of Cleveland. The crew attempted to steer to shore and lodged the ship on a sandbar. WebThe largest vessel lost was that of the steamship Karitane, 1376 tons, which crashed into cliffs directly below the lighthouse on Christmas Eve, 1920. The collier Bulli, 524 tons, is second on the list, sitting upright on the bottom of West Cove. The Buli, in particular, is a popular dive. Reference. free ecards for thanksgiving day

Amazon's Choice in Crepe Paper by Lia Griffith-14% ... free ecards funny birthday for himWebThe Michael Griffith was a Castle class steam trawler built for the Admiralty and launched on 5 September 1918 by Cook Welton & Gemmell of Beverley (Yard No.402). Her steel hull measured 125.5’ x 23.5’ x 12.7’, with tonnage of 282 gross and 109 net. The vessel was powered by a triple expansion steam engine provided by Amos & Smith of Hull. free e cards for sympathy for a deathWeb10 Jun 2024 · The Barnwell brothers measuring a cannon discovered at the wreck site.
